Selecting the Correct Type of Satellite Dish Antenna

You need to select the correct type of dish antenna that you have connected, so that the HD
receiver can calculate the correct coordinates for pointing the dish antenna.
Highlighting the Dish Setup button on the
INSTALLATION screen and pressing the
key on the remote control will display th e DISH
SETUP screen. Highlighting the Dish Type button
on the DISH SETUP screen and pressing the
key on the remote control will display th e DISH
TYPE pop-up menu. Press the and keys to
highlight the type of dish antenna that is connected
to the HD receiver and then press the key.

Dish Type Selections

Note: You must select the correct
dish antenna type to obtain correct pointing results.
These are the following dish antenna type selections:
None Highlight this selection if you are not connecting a dish antenna, but are
connecting a terrestrial antenna or cable signal.
Round Dish Highlight this selection if you connected an 18" round dish antenna. This
setting allows the HD receiver to receive a signal from the main satellite,
located at 101°.
Note: A round dish antenna will not recei ve High Definition satellite signals
from DIRECTV.
